Indonesia, Jakarta: In an effort to cater to Greater Jakarta’s rapid development, state electricity company PLN plans to invest billions of dollars in building a number of new power plants and transmission networks in the area.
Kazakhstan, Kentau: Kazakhstan’s Kentau transformer plant has assembles its first power transformer with the capacity of 80 MVA, capable of providing electricity to 10 districts in the country.
USA, Los Angeles: Scattered transformer fires around Los Angeles left thousands of Los Angeles Department of Water and Power (LADWP) customers without electricity on Monday morning following the overnight rain storm.
One very important component of a power transformer is the on-load tap changer (OLTC). The principal of the Dynamic Resistance Measurement (DRM) was developed to analyze the switching process of OLTCs.
USA, Utah: Last month someone with a high-powered rifle fired several shots and successfully disabled a substation owned by Garkane Energy Cooperative, leading to a day-long power outage for about 13,000 Utah residents.
Japan, Tokyo: Mitsubishi Electric Corporation announced today that it will enter the global market for voltage-sourced converters (VSC) based high-voltage direct current (HVDC) systems with a new HVDC verification facility to be built at its Transmission and Distribution Centre in Amagasaki, Japan by 2018.
Germany, Niestetal: The new substation at the Sandershäuser mountain in Niestetal, Germany is taking shape, with the large power transformer from the Netherlands delivered to the site.

Kenya, Nairobi: According to the statement by Kenya Power’s CEO, the national utility is currently running power projects valued at around $280 million, which will promote local transformer and electrical equipment manufacturers.
France, Cadarache: Last week a 14-metre long transformer supplied to ITER, world’s largest tokamak, by a manufacturer in China was moved to its permanent location.
Germany, Berlin: A fire broke out on 11 October on the roof of the Europa-Center, a landmark shopping centre in Western Berlin, recognizable by a rotating Mercedes-Benz star, which might have been caused by a faulty transformer, European media report.
Mayor Dwight Lethbridge worries 200-tonne transformers will damage town roads
Canada, Newfoundland and Labrador: The mayor of Cartwright, a Sandwich Bay community in the province of Newfoundland and Labrador, Canada says his town should be compensated for the role it will play in the Muskrat Falls project as Nalcor finalizes plans to ship seven 200-tonne transformers to the work site by way of the port in that community.

Germany: German power regulation company Maschinenfabrik Reinhausen GmbH (MR) has invested in Gridco Systems, a start-up company offering next-generation power electronics devices to actively manage voltage and reactive power at the distribution circuit level, which has raised $12 million in a funding round including existing investors and MR as a strategic investor.

Switzerland, Zurich: ABB has developed, manufactured and energized a 1,200 kV ultra-high-voltage power transformer to support India’s plans to build a 1,200 kV transmission system, supplementing the existing 400 kV and 800 kV transmission grids.
Germany: TransnetBW, a transmission network operator in the German state of Baden-Württemberg, recently installed a 420 kV power transformer in one of its substations in southwest Germany that is cooled and insulated with natural ester fluid.
